Report filed by the government of Rajasthan, Department of Environment and Climate Change dated 16/02/2023.

The Principal Bench of the National Green Tribunal, February 15, 2023 in the matter of Dr Abid Ali Khan Vs State of Rajasthan & Others had directed the Chief Secretary, Rajasthan to file a report on the Sambhar festival and its effects, if any, on the ecology.

Order of the National Green Tribunal in the matter of Dr. Abid Ali Khan Vs State of Rajasthan dated 15/02/2023.

Grievance in the application is against proposed Sambhar festival between 17 – 19 February, 2023 at Sambhar Lake near Jaipur. This will involve activities like kite flying, paragliding, motorcycle expedition. According to the applicant such activities will adversely affect migratory birds and natural habitat of the lake which is a Ramsar site, particularly on account of use of loudspeakers.

Joint committee report to the National Green Tribunal order (Original Application 94 of 2022) dated 07/12/2022.

The matter related to encroachment within the area of Sambhar lake and use of unauthorised borewells by a large number of unauthorized persons.

The committee recommended that the Department of Environment shall refine and validate the map prepared by the State Remote Sensing Application Centre (SRSAC), Jodhpur in 1990 in coordination with Survey of India.
